Some believers think tongues are always earthly languages. For this group has anyone checked and verified their tongues are an earthly language ?

Is it even possible to do this? One would have to record every incident of speaking in tongues and then have a means to filter it through all the known tongues that ever existed. This seems to be an impossible task.

I assume the languages would only be current ones in use otherwise who would they benefit ? Once again I am only speaking about people who believe tongues are only earthly languages.

Yes it would be a very difficult task but not impossible. A linguist might have a fair idea where to start.

Since you have set a parameter upon your replies, I will bow out because I believe there are also heavenly tongues. Good luck with your question.

And also, how do you "teach" someone to speak in tongues? I also saw something similar about people "teaching" others to prophesy. IMO it just seems wrong, your either blessed with the gift or your not.

Well, the prophecy thing is a whole other ball of wax, because one has to learn to discern their own thoughts and impressions from what the Holy Spirit actually gave.

The only teaching for how to speak in tongues that I know of is how to express the faith to get started. Not everyone starts spontaneously - most of us have our rational minds in the way that needs to be overcome.
